The database on normal cardiac dimensions has been established in Europe using 1.5T magnetic resonance scanner. However, there is no similar database using 3T cardiac magnetic resonance scanner and for Asian population. Objective: To evaluate the right and left cardiac ventricular dimensions in healthy volunteers with 3-Tesla magnetic resonance imaging. Methodology: Fifty subjects (25 males, 25 females) without cardiovascular diseases were evaluated with 3T magnetic resonance scanner, using a steadystate free precession sequence (balanced turbo field-echo). Result: Mean age was 28.04 for male and 30.12 for female. Right and left ventricular volumes and mass were larger in males than females. RV EDV 153.83 ± 22.67 ml vs 144.46 ± 14.92ml, RV ESV 67.58 ± 14.44 ml vs 47.58 ± 9.49 ml, RV SV 86.24 ± 11.74ml vs 66.97± 8.57 ml, RV mass 35.88 ± 8.18 g vs 26.29 ± 5.26 g. LV EDV 129.05 ± 18.3 ml vs 105.44 ± 13.91 ml, LV ESV 46.65 ± 9.56 ml vs 37.92 ± 8.39 ml, LV SV 82.42 ± 12.02 ml vs 67.52 ± 8.33ml, LV mass 107.04 ± 16.55 g vs 65.92 ± 8.49 g; (p ˂0.05 for all). There was no difference in ejection fraction of right and left ventricles between the genders.
